"Leadership expert, John C. Maxwell says, 'Not all readers are leaders, but all leaders are readers.' One of the outstanding leaders I know is Nate Parks. Whether he is taking his kids to an activity or waiting for the gas tank to fill, he always has a book with him. By having the reading material with him at all times, looking for chances to read a few more pages, Nate read many books a year. Mrs. Klein, my daughter's kindergarten teacher wisely said, 'Reading is critical because in the first three years of school, one learns to read. After that, one reads to learn.'"
David Horsager, The Trust Edge: What Top Leaders Have & 8 Pillars to Build It, p. 133.
